ABOUT
StepUp4ICU is a bi-national fundraising challenge supporting the future of intensive care across Australia and New Zealand.
Each year, more than 200,000 people are admitted to intensive care units. Behind every one of these admissions is a person, a family and a story.
By taking on the StepUp4ICU challenge, walking or running 200,000 steps, you are recognising every one of those patients and the incredible teams who care for them.
Australia and New Zealand have some of the best ICU survival rates in the world. This is made possible through ongoing investment in research, education and training. But there is always more to be done to improve outcomes and support recovery after critical illness.
Funds raised through StepUp4ICU help advance life-saving research, support education and educator scholarships for ICU professionals and provide opportunities for the next generation of intensive care leaders.
